About Us
Founded in 2019, Rx Connect Specialty Pharmacy is a proud Canadian company, comprised of healthcare professionals with extensive specialty medication experience with a location in Mississauga, Ontario and another opening soon in Calgary, Alberta. We are a distinctive healthcare company, with patient relationship skills that set us apart. We mainly deal with patients who require biologics/specialty medications used in the treatment of chronic medical con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, psoriatic arthritis, urticaria, ulcerative colitis, and many others.
At Rx Connect Specialty Pharmacy, we provide patient-centric healthcare and assist patients in overcoming the challenges of specialty pharmacy. We utilize innovative strategies to deliver patients access to specialized therapy in a cost-effective, timely and caring manner leading to improved adherence, therapeutic success and overall well-being.
